The word "metal"is derived from the Greek word "metallon" which means a pit or a mine, whence we get"metal". Technically it is a term applied to a number of elementary substances which possess, generally, certain well-defined characteristics, such as lustre, malleability, ductility, and fusibility.
The broad definition of a"metal"is as follows: A solid opaque body, possessing a peculiar lustre, fusibility, and conductivity.
